We're located in New Orleans, and this Carnival season, we're selling king cakes. King cakes are one of the few Carnival traditions that people can enjoy this year, since all of the parades and balls have been cancelled.
I've been trying to create a buy one, give one option, so that when customers add a king cake to their cart, they have the option of buying one at a discounted price for frontline workers. (We're partnering with a Carnival krewe that will distribute the cakes to hospitals so our customers don't have to do it themselves.)
I've looked for an app that will help me do this, but can't find anything. I've tried to create a discount code, but that's clunky, because I want it to be a suggested sale as they're checking out. Is there something I'm missing? I could set up a donation feature via an app (e.g. "Donate to our king cake fund for frontline workers!"), but that's a little different. I really want customers to know that they're buying an actual king cake.
Solved! Go to the solution
Hi @NOLA70117 ,
The best way to do this would be by setting up an Automatic Buy X Get Y Discount from the Shopify Backend.
That way they would have to add two cakes to the cart and at checkout they will get the discount. You can alleviate this clunkiness by adding comms via banners or text telling the customers what the offer is!
I thought about that approach, but I'm worried that it will create too much confusion--it will look more like a buy one get one than a buy one give one. Plus, customers would have to know about it in advance, so that they can add multiples to their cart. It would get especially confusing for folks who want more than one king cake for themselves.
What would work best is a hidden product (which I can't figure out either). So when people add a king cake to their cart, they get access to a hidden item--namely, the king cake for frontline workers. Thoughts?
Go to your "Discounts" tab on the lefthand side, Click on "Create Discount" then "Automatic Discount" and follow the steps!
Let me know if that solves it for you !